Productive irrigated ranch for sale in Montrose, Colorado

Located just three miles north of the popular Montrose Regional Airport, this historic ranch property offers a variety of options, whether as a working farm and ranch property, development property, or flexible combination of both. The Montrose area is one of the fastest-growing hubs in western Colorado, with a hot housing market and new commercial and light industrial projects locating in Montrose. This property has an attractive combination of irrigated ranch land vacant development land easy highway and county road access excellent infrastructure, including power, domestic water, fiber internet, and natural gas and easy access to the airport, shopping, schools, and workplaces.

Large acreage farm and ranch parcel in close proximity to Montrose, Colorado

With a total of 470 acres, this is one of the largest parcels in close proximity to Montrose. With 220 shares of Uncompahgre Valley Water Users Association Uvwua water, it is well irrigated, but it's possible to put more acreage into production using the runoff water from the existing fields. Today's production is grass cattle pasture and grass-alfalfa hay, but the property has historically been used to grow all manner of crops, including onions, pinto beans, corn, and vegetables, in addition to its current role as a cattle ranch. There is no residence on the property, but a building site for a duplex barndominium has been prepared, complete with county-approved plans, installed water line, and septic system. Near the building site is a newly built 30x100 metal-sided hay barn made with structural tubular steel trusses. The property has newly built 4-strand barbed-wire fencing and several gathering corrals for cattle. A small part of the acreage is zoned commercial, as it is the site of a former dairy.

Montrose, CO is a recreation hotspot for Western Colorado-skiing, hunting, fishing, 4-wheeling

For the recreation enthusiast, it's hard to beat Montrose, Colorado, which has gateways to recreation in all directions. To the south lie the stunning San Juan mountains, home to Telluride's world-class skiing, as well as many rugged mountain passes for 4-wheeling and ATV enthusiasts. The entire area is known for world-class hunting for elk, mule deer, bear, grouse, and even waterfowl. To the west is the Uncompahgre Plateau, a vast area of BLM and National Forest lands that is famous for elk and mule deer hunting, and the Divide Road offers superb snowmobiling. North of Montrose is the world's largest flat-topped mountain, the Grand Mesa, which has 300 lakes and reservoirs full of trout, along with a myriad of trails for ATV riding and snowmobiling. East of town is the famous Black Canyon of the Gunnison, which is famous for its Gold Medal trout fishing, not to mention the excellent hunting near Cimarron. Canyoneering, camping, hiking, horseback riding, mountain biking, rafting, bird watching, rock climbing-it's all near Montrose.
